Greeting
The courtyard turned into utter chaos, a spectacle beyond even Professor Crewel's wildest dreams. You were the unfortunate center of attention in this Twisted Wonderland drama.
Heartslabyul: Riddle, practically exploding with anger, shouted Queen of Hearts rules nonstop. Trey offered tarts, but no one cared. Cater filmed everything for Magicam, complete with emojis. Ace and Deuce, standing close together, awkwardly tried to get your attention.
Savanaclaw: Leona, looking lazy but dangerous, acted like he owned you. Ruggie saw the situation as a money-making opportunity. Jack, conflicted, stood guard, unsure what to do. The rest of the dorm formed a protective barrier, ready to defend their territory.
Octavinelle: Azul offered contracts full of sneaky terms. The twins, Floyd and Jade, stayed close, smiling in a way that made you uneasy. Whispers spread, subtly trying to influence everyone to their side.
Scaravia: Kalim showered you with gifts and promises, completely over the top. Jamil struggled to keep him in check, looking stressed. The other students in the dorm didn't know what to do.
Pomefiore: Vil looked you up and down, judging everything. Rook compared you to ancient goddesses in flowery language. Epel stood in front of you, blushing but determined to protect you. The dorm showed off their best qualities, hoping to win you over.
Ignihyde: Idia, hiding behind his screens, sent you a flood of emojis. Ortho scanned the crowd for any danger. The dorm analyzed the situation from a distance, offering advice that wasn't very helpful.
Diasomnia: Malleus, with his powerful aura, watched with a hint of amusement. Lilia smiled, seeming to know something you didn't. Silver leaned on Sebek, torn between his loyalty and his own feelings. The rest of the dorm stayed quiet, adding to the mystery.
You were trapped in a sea of faces, each showing a mix of longing, obsession, and confusion. The air buzzed with unspoken desires. Your goal: survive this disaster..
